    RE-RELEASE: Fulvia: Original Gangster of Ancient Rome

    19/03/2026 | 1h 38 mins.
    ⁠⁠Help keep our podcast going by contributing to our Patreon!

    The romance between Mark Antony and Cleopatra has beguiled us for centuries. What most people don’t realize is that when Mark Antony met Cleopatra, he was already married—to someone just as epic. Her name was Fulvia.

    Cleopatra had glamour and divinity and lots of money. But Fulvia had the gangs. She was a populist firebrand, military leader, and for a while, the undisputed power in Rome: both in the Senate and in the streets.

    ALL IN ONE PLACE: Julius Caesar Parts 1 & 2

    12/03/2026 | 2h 8 mins.
    Help keep our podcast going by contributing to our Patreon! ⁠

    We're on hiatus until April 9. Until then, enjoy this long, binge-able episode on Julius Caesar's early life.

    Most accounts of Caesar's life start later on--such as during his time in Gaul or crossing the Rubicon. But his early life was just as fascinating; maybe even more so.

    This is the Caesar who stood up to Sulla and refused to divorce his wife. The Caesar who made an early career of prosecuting corrupt governors to cement his cred as a populist--even as it made him powerful enemies. The Caesar who, when kidnapped by pirates, demanded they raise his ransom and spent his time in captivity hanging out on the beach and reading them bad poetry.

    It's a fun, lighthearted introduction to Caesar's life before it takes its dark turn. We hope you enjoy.

    RE-RELEASE: Spartacus vs. Toussaint L'Ouverture (With Mike Duncan)

    05/03/2026 | 1h 13 mins.
    ⁠Help keep our podcast going by contributing to our Patreon!

    More than 1,800 years after Spartacus fought for his freedom, another rebel leader spearheaded the most successful slave revolt in history: the Haitian Revolution. That leader was a man named Toussaint L’Ouverture.

    This week, we invited Mike Duncan of The History of Rome and Revolutions to help us compare these two revolutionaries and discuss what advice Toussaint L'Ouverture might have had for Spartacus.
